由於全新的後台優化,適用於 Windows 10/11 平台的 Chrome 瀏覽器運行速度更快了。在 Google 和微軟的共同努力下,雙方一直試圖通過節制 JavaScript 來減少後台標籤的優先級。到目前為止,這些努力已經減少了基於 Chromium核心的瀏覽器的 CPU、GPU 和記憶體的使用,從而讓你更加順暢使用瀏覽器。
而在2020年10月, Google 推出了 Chrome 86 ,隨同發布的還有一項名為(Native Window Occlusion)的新功能。該功能已使用了一年多的時間,官方近日公開了該功能所帶來的一些性能優勢。
如上文所述,過去,Google 的解決方案一直僅限於後台標籤,但並未對後台的視窗進行相應的處理。現在當 Chrome 瀏覽器窗口最小化到任務欄、移出螢幕等情況下,這些視窗也會像後台標籤一樣處理,這明顯有助於提高 Chrome 瀏覽器的性能。
基於這項假設,Google 開始研究「Native Window Occlusion」計畫,以減少被遮蔽視窗(使用者無法主動看到)中標籤的後台使用。
Google已經在這個計畫上工作了三年多,它解決了與多顯示器設定、虛擬桌面等的相容性問題。作為優化計畫的一部分,Google忽略了最小化的窗口(使用者不可見)、虛擬桌面等情境。
Google在一篇文章中指出,Google已經對該功能進行了一段時間的測試,現在已經向Windows上的每個人開放。
按照Google的說法,現在Chrome瀏覽器的啟動速度提高了25.8%,它觀察到GPU記憶體的使用減少了3.1%。同樣,Google報告說,算繪器框架減少了20.4%,算繪崩潰減少了4.5%。
請注意!留言要自負法律責任,相關案例層出不窮,請慎重發文!